Cinnamon Sticks for a Spicy Fragrance
Cinnamon sticks add a warm and spicy fragrance to potpourri and are perfect for festive crafts. Also known as quills, these sticks aren’t as fragrant as you would expect. Breaking them open releases the subtle spicy fragrance, however it’s common to boost the scent by adding cinnamon home fragrance oil or to buy ready made scented sticks. For a warm touch in your kitchen or lounge, use these on their own for a modern look or in a potpourri mix for a blend of fragrances, colours and shapes.
Cinnamon Handmade Potpourri

This hand-mixed potpourri is made up of pine cones, seed pods and flowers with a rich warm scent, enhanced by a few drops of cinnamon fragrance oil. Items you might find in the mix are cinnamon sticks, cedar roses, pine cones, alder cones, brunch balls, casurina pods, cotton pods, bellani slice, helichrysum flowers. The sweet spicy fragrance is perfect for your kitchen.
Although perfect for potpourri, cinnamon sticks are also great for crafts over the festive period. Use a glue gun to add the quills to mixed Christmas wreaths and garlands alongside pine cones, foliage, baubles and ribbons.
